    Default Been doing a little tying

    I have been tying up some kiptail dressed jigs recently. Just thought I would put up a pic of some of them to see what you all think about them. These are the hottest color combos that we caught fish on last year in the winter and spring.
    I poured up some 1/32 oz. heads on some Eagle Claw 574 long shank #4 hooks, coated the heads with a few different colors of the Pro-Tec powder paint, and added some kiptail hair in some hot colors and am now waiting on the weather to cool down here some to try them out!

    LoL...Thanks fellas....I'll tell you what we fished these little jigs on a jig pole in the brush tops and did really good but we really wore them out fishing these under a small bobber with spinning reels. We found that when the fish were real shallow we could not get up close enough to the tops to fish without spooking them, so thats when we broke out the spinning reels and WOW!!!!...I caught my largest fish of the year on the white head and orange tail.

    They are different without a body, but look good too. I just like feathers on my jigs because the undulate in the water and look alive even if you are barely moving it. I use hackle and marabou feathers for my tails.

    Only thing that really counts though is if the fish like it then it's good, LOL!
